whoami:显示当前用户
ls:该命令用于列出目录的内容。它提供了多个选项来实现不同的功能。您可以使用' man ls '命令了解更多关于' ls '可用选项的信息。
以下是其中一些。
语法:ls
选项:
创建一个长列表
-包括隐藏的目录和文件
指定目录或文件的-d列表
-R显示完整的树结构
-h人类可读的形式
这里有一个样品供你参考:
[root@localhost /]# ls -l
total 60
lrwxrwxrwx. 1 root root 7 Jul 14 2016 bin -> usr/bin
dr-xr-xr-x. 4 root root 4096 Mar 13 2016 boot
drwxr-xr-x. 19 root root 3000 Mar 20 11:17 dev
drwxr-xr-x. 74 root root 4096 Mar 20 13:22 etc
drwxr-xr-x. 5 root root 4096 Mar 21 03:36 home
lrwxrwxrwx. 1 root root 7 Jul 14 2016 lib -> usr/lib
lrwxrwxrwx. 1 root root 9 Jul 14 2016 lib64 -> usr/lib64
drwx------. 2 root root 16384 Jul 14 2016 lost+found
drwxr-xr-x. 2 root root 4096 Jun 9 2016 media
drwxr-xr-x. 2 root root 4096 Jun 9 2014 mnt
drwxr-xr-x. 2 root root 4096 Jun 9 2016 opt
dr-xr-xr-x. 96 root root 0 Mar 20 11:16 proc
dr-xr-x---. 4 root root 4096 Mar 20 13:29 root
drwxr-xr-x. 23 root root 680 Mar 20 13:22 run
lrwxrwxrwx. 1 root root 8 Jul 14 2016 sbin -> usr/sbin
drwxr-xr-x. 2 root root 4096 Jun 9 2016 srv
dr-xr-xr-x. 13 root root 0 Mar 20 11:16 sys
drwxrwxrwt. 7 root root 4096 Mar 21 04:34 tmp
drwxr-xr-x. 13 root root 4096 Jul 14 2014 usr
drwxr-xr-x. 20 root root 4096 Mar 20 11:16 var
[root@localhost /]#
5) cd (Change Directory):此命令用于导航到另一个目录。
语法:cd <路径到新目录>
变化:
cd导航到主目录
cd . .返回一级
cd . . / . .返回两个级别
导航到最后使用的目录
cd ~切换到根目录
6) mkdir(创建目录):此命令用于创建一个新目录。
语法:mkdir <目录名>
变化:
mkdir 同时创建多个目录
mkdir //创建嵌套目录
rmdir(删除目录):此命令用于删除目录。
语法:rmdir <目录名>
变化:
rmdir -p / /
(删除目录及其后续目录)
触摸命令用于在目录中创建空文件。
语法:触摸<文件名>
“清除”命令用于清除屏幕并将光标移到页面顶部。
此命令用于查看文件。它还可以用来连接多个文件
语法:cat <文件名>
变化:
头<文件名>查看文件的前十行
查看文件的最后十行
将两个文件合并到一个新的第三个文件中:cat >>
cp此命令用于复制文件或目录。
语法:cp
选项:
-r复制目录及其内容(递归)
-p复制与相关的权限
- f力操作
此命令用于复制文件或目录或重命名它。
语法:mv <源> <目的>
重命名一个目录或文件:mv <旧名> <新名>
此命令用于删除文件或目录。
语法:rm
变化:
删除包含内容的目录(递归)
rm -f强制操作此命令用于搜索文件和目录中的字符串。这个命令有许多变体。我们可以用“人”命令来指示他们。
最常见的有:
" find / -iname ",用于搜索文件的所有目录(不区分大小写)
" find / -iname <*text*> ",用于搜索所有目录(不区分大小写)中的特定文本
>将“/”替换为/joesmith等初始搜索目录,以限制搜索
>对大小写敏感的搜索使用“-name”而不是“-iname”
grep命令用于查找文件中的某些文本。这里有一个例子供你参考:
[root@localhost b]# cat /etc/sysconfig/network-scripts/ifcfg-eth0 | grep -i bootproto
输出:BOOTPROTO = dhcp
变化:
grep—忽略情况
grep -v反转匹配
它是一个用于编辑文件的文本编辑器,当我们给出带有文件名的“vi”命令时,它会在编辑器中打开文件。它是一个多功能的编辑器,有多个选项可以复制、粘贴或格式化文本。编辑器默认处于命令模式。只需按“Esc i”键,即可进入插入模式。
顾名思义,“关机”命令用于关闭系统。在使用关闭命令时,可以使用某些变体。您可以立即关闭系统或设置一个计时器。系统也可以通过关闭命令重新启动。
•立即关闭系统
shutdown -h now
•5分钟后关闭系统
shutdown -h +5
•重新启动系统
shutdown -r now
More命令用于通过提供滚动选项来读取具有大量行数的文件。它可以用类似的语法代替“cat”命令。
例如:
more<文件名>
此命令用于更改当前用户的密码。
这是样品供你参考。
[root@localhost network-scripts] #passwd
更改用户根的密码。
New password:
exit 这个命令用于退出系统。
总结
Linux操作系统包含大量的命令,用于它执行的许多活动。范围相当大。通过本文,我们能够介绍大多数发行版在Linux中使用的一些最基本的命令。
(转载:www.idcew.com)